This book is lushly put together by Princess Maria Gabriella the oldest daughter of the last King and Queen of Italy and by far the most knowledgeable and serious of the 4. She was a devoted daughter to both parents and learned many details of the gems and history of the dynasty.Her explanations are very detailed and the photographs are unbelievable. Too bad that because of circumstances so many of these works of the jewelers' art have been sold. We can only hope that they are not broken up as so many historical pieces have in the past.The section of the jewels that were left in the Bank of Rome when the royal family left are incredible. Too bad that they are not placed on display so that they can be enjoyed like the other royal jewels around the world.I bought this book in Rome (in original Italian) and strongly recommend it to all lovers of the jeweler's art as well as those interested in the Savoys.

The House of Savoy had three Italian Queens and Queen Margherita, like Queen Mary of England was a jewellery lover. She bought diamonds and other jewels like pearls to enhance her royal presence and they often pay off in rather stunning jewel draped images of her. The book follows the lives and jewels of Queen Elena and Queen Marie Jose as well as Margherita. Their jewels are shown in lovely clear photos where they survive and enhanced with many rare, large size, photos of them being worn by the various Queens. This is one of the best books of royal jewels out there to concentrate on a specific family. If you love jewels or are interested in royal families this book is hard to pass up.
